In May of 2008, Gov. Perdue signed HB1133 into
law. This allows Georgia taxpayers to direct their tax
dollars to private schools. It also gives private schools
an opportunity to offer scholarships to students. We are
excited to be working with
Georgia
Student Scholarship, Inc. (GASSO) and have already had two
meetings in regards to the benefits for taxpayers and those
seeking scholarships. Two $2,250 scholarships have already
been awarded. These meetings described the process of how
to donate to receive a dollar for dollar tax credit (up to
$2,500 for married filing jointly) on
GA state taxes
and how a student can receive thousands of dollars in
scholarships.
